The 2024 session began in the Carinthia Mountains, in southern Austria, where Prince Emmanuel has from Liechtenstein and maintains an outdoor animal garden and a park for games on the ancient castle ruin. A colony includes about thirty of the northern bald nests in the cage, which can be accessed through an open window. They consider a “wilderness”-a flying empty, except in the winter-but often stable, which means that they do not migrate.

In early April, these birds hatched the chicks. Within a week, Zookeeper, Lin Havener, moved from the nest to the nest to determine the most appropriate. It was removed from the parents ’nests – a close process, but it is dedicated to the benefit of special species, as humans themselves – and they were transferred to the shipping container, where they were subjected to the care of incubating mothers. The incubator mothers live mainly inside the container. They move from the nest to the nest, sit with birds, sing and talk to them, and even spit on their food, to give the birds a gastrointestinal enzyme in the saliva. (For this, incubating mothers must give up caffeine, tobacco and alcohol.)
